## Summary  
MCFNS Publishing Group is a United States-based research institute focused on advancing scholarly research in Mathematical and Computational Forestry & Natural-Resource Sciences. It supports academic publishing and peer-reviewed research dissemination through its editorial policies and institutional framework.

### Overview  
MCFNS Publishing Group operates as a research institute situated in the United States. It focuses specifically on the discipline of Mathematical and Computational Forestry & Natural-Resource Sciences (MCFNS), which integrates quantitative methods into forest and natural resource studies.

### Classification and Focus Area  
The group is formally categorized as a research institute, according to both Wikidata classification and self-reported documentation. Its core subject domain includes:

- Application of mathematical modeling in forestry
- Use of computational techniques for natural-resource analysis
- Interdisciplinary research combining ecology, economics, and systems theory

This specialization positions it uniquely among broader environmental or agricultural research organizations.
